Where does “ընդհանուր” come from?

ընդհանուր (Armenian) comes from Old Armenian ընդհանուր, from Old Armenian ընդ, from Proto-Indo-European h₂énti, from Proto-Indo-European h₂énts, from Proto-Indo-European h₂ent-, from Proto-Indo-European h₂en- — on, onto.

ընդհանուր (Armenian): general, universal, common; generally, in general

Definitions

  1. general, universal, common; generally, in general
